Kernel version 0.9 :

- bugfix in SSC setup (SYS/KM.VSDRIVE.S.txt, drivers)
- various cleanup/fix in KMs
This commit is contained in:
Rémy GIBERT 2017-04-10 10:58:45 +02:00
parent e4f2c60ada
commit 12217347d4
8 changed files with 6 additions and 6 deletions

View File

@ -130,11 +130,11 @@ OPEN ldx DEVSLOTn0
sei
stz SSC.RESET,x
lda #$1E
lda #SSC.CTL.CLKINT+SSC.CTL.B9600+SSC.CTL.8D+SSC.CTL.1S+SSC.CMD.NOP
sta SSC.CTL,x
ldx DEVSLOTn0
lda #SSC.CMD.RIRQDIS
lda #SSC.CMD.RIRQDIS+SSC.CMD.TE+SSC.CMD.DTR
sta SSC.CMD,x
lda SSC.STATUS,x clear any IRQ pending

View File

@ -139,7 +139,7 @@ OPEN php
stz OUTBUF.HEAD
stz OUTBUF.TAIL
lda #SSC.CTL.CLKINT+SSC.CTL.B9600
lda #SSC.CTL.CLKINT+SSC.CTL.B9600+SSC.CTL.8D+SSC.CTL.1S+SSC.CMD.NOP
sta SSC.CTL,x
lda #SSC.CMD.TEIRQ+SSC.CMD.TE+SSC.CMD.DTR

Binary file not shown.

Binary file not shown.

Binary file not shown.

View File

@ -52,8 +52,8 @@ RW.Init >LDAXI RW.MSG
ror .11+1
.11 ldx #$00
pha Push Kbyte HI
phx Push Kbyte LO
pha Push Kbyte HI
>LDAXI RW.MSG.OK1
jsr PrintCStrAX
@ -664,5 +664,5 @@ RWDRVX.SIZE .EQ RWDRVX.B.END-RWDRVX.B.START
.FIN
*--------------------------------------
MAN
SAVE /ASOSX.SRC/SYS/KM.RAMWORKS.S
SAVE /A2OSX.SRC/SYS/KM.RAMWORKS.S
ASM

View File

@ -122,7 +122,7 @@ SSC.Detect stz TmpPtr1
lda #SSC.CTL.CLKINT+SSC.CTL.B115200+SSC.CTL.8D+SSC.CTL.1S+SSC.CMD.NOP
sta SSC.CTL,x
lda #SSC.CMD.RIRQDIS
lda #SSC.CMD.RIRQDIS+SSC.CMD.TE+SSC.CMD.DTR
sta SSC.CMD,x
lda TmpPtr1+1